Constitutional Court of Thailand The Constitutional Court of Thailand invalidates the general election held on February 2, on the grounds that voting was not held on the same day throughout the country.
Qiubei County A kindergarten lunch in Qiubei County, China, is poisoned, leaving two children dead and another thirty sick.
Bernard A. Friedman American judge Bernard A. Friedman of the United States District Court for the Eastern District of Michigan overturns Michigan's ban on same-sex marriages.
2014 Crimean crisis The President of Russia Vladimir Putin signs the legislation completing the annexation of Crimea.
The Russian Federation Council, the upper house of the Federal Assembly, approves the annexation of Crimea.
Turkey Turkey restricts access to Twitter hours after the Prime Minister Recep Tayyip Erdoğan threatens to "root out" the social network where politically sensitive documents had been published.
Tripoli Clashes erupt in Tripoli, Lebanon, between Syrian regime supporters and detractors, leaving three dead.
Baghdad Gunmen attack a police headquarters north of Baghdad and suicide bombers strike across Iraq killing 25 people and injuring dozens.
